Chapter 142 Zhu Ying's Horror
Chapter 142 Zhu Ying's Horror
Zhu Di still doesn't know about Yao Guangxiao's transformation.
But he can't take care of Yao Guangxiao anymore, because tomorrow morning, he will set off for the coast as the coach of Pingwo East Road.
In the 23rd year of Hongwu, when Zhu Di and Zhu Min divided their forces to attack the remnants of the Meng Yuan, he was also the commander of the East Road.
Everything now is like history repeating itself, and Zhu Di certainly understands the meaning of it.
His big victory last time completely covered up the radiance of his third brother Zhu Yan, but what will happen this time, I don't know.
The entire King Yan's mansion has already started to pack their bags, and they will set off in the early morning of tomorrow.
"Chi'er, you should stay in the capital well and study hard."
Zhu Di said to Zhu Gaochi.
After he finished speaking, he hesitated for a while, and then said: "If possible, it shouldn't be a bad thing to get closer to your elder brother."
Zhu Gaochi seldom heard such gentle words from his father, and was a little at a loss.
On weekdays, his father didn't like him, he mostly reprimanded him, and he was not pleasing to the eye.
After a short period of adaptation, Zhu Gaochi also understood his father's thoughts, and replied: "My child will definitely remember my father's instruction."
Zhu Di nodded, and waved his hand to let Zhu Gaochi go down. It's pretty good to be able to say a few more words.
Zhu Gaochi left the lobby without disturbing his father.
It was just that when turning the corner, he paused slightly, as if hesitating, but finally chose to leave without turning back to speak.
Although Zhu Gaochi is a bit fat, he can be considered smart.
As for the plans of the father and Yao Guangxiao, even if they didn't deliberately eavesdrop on anything, they would certainly have guesses under the same roof every day.
"Father, why do you have to be jealous of that position? Why don't we be vassal kings? Beiping and Ming Dynasty are like flies in a tree, and the light of fireflies competes with the bright moon."
"And if it's a bad one, there's no way out, and it's a way to lose everything."
"Even if it is to cut down the vassal, with Yun Wen's temperament, our family will be able to take care of it, it won't be like this."
Zhu Gaochi was much smarter than Zhu Di imagined.
Perhaps because of his overweight body, his two younger brothers and his father were not very friendly to him.Zhu Gaochi's mind is more sensitive than ordinary people.
Zhu Gaochi and several other heirs, including Zhu Yunqi, grew up together and have a good relationship.
But some time ago, the prince Zhu Biao passed away and Zhu Yunqi was positioned as the grandson.
Zhu Gaochi discovered that Zhu Yunqi deliberately kept a distance from the sons of the vassal princes.
At first, he just thought that this change was due to the change of status. After all, Zhu Yunqi would be the emperor of Ming Dynasty in the future, and the relationship between them was first and foremost a relationship between monarch and minister.
But soon Zhu Gaochi discovered that Zhu Yunqi hadn't changed much in getting along with other people except for the sons of the vassal princes.
This made Zhu Gaochi a little puzzled, and then inadvertently inquired about some of Huang Zicheng's claims, especially about the vassal king.
Zhu Gaochi immediately understood Zhu Yunqi's choice.
In fact, such things as cutting feudal vassals have happened in all dynasties. Zhu Gaochi has read history books and knows the truth.
It's just that the father is obviously not reconciled, so he just missed the throne.
Sighing softly, in the face of such a situation, it is not Zhu Gaochi who can intervene.
As the eldest son of King Yan, no matter what the situation is, he must support his father.
It didn't take long for Li Jinglong to arrive at Yan Wang's mansion.
"Jing Long, why are you free today?" Zhu Di asked with a smile.
"Your Highness is going to fight against Japan tomorrow, so I came here to congratulate His Highness." Li Jinglong replied.
Zhu Di looked around at the guards and servants, and led Li Jinglong to the study to discuss matters.
"Cousin, what happened to Master Daoyan?"
As soon as he entered the study, Li Jinglong frowned and asked.
Yesterday he looked for Dao Yan, but found that he couldn't find anyone, so he came to ask him personally.
"Master Daoyan has been imprisoned in the Sutra Pavilion of Tianjie Temple." Zhu Di said in a deep voice.
Li Jinglong was surprised when he heard this, and hurriedly said, "How is this possible."
Yao Guangxiao was in charge of overall planning and arrangements, and Li Jinglong was clear about these things, after all, he had already taken refuge in Zhu Di.
In other words, he has always stood by Zhu Di's side.
"That kid Zhu Ying did it." Zhu Di replied with a frown.
"Zhu Ying?"
Hearing this name, Li Jinglong was a little puzzled.
After Zhu Di heard the sound, he realized that Yao Guangxiao did not tell Li Jinglong about Zhu Ying's existence.
So he explained Zhu Ying to Li Jinglong.
After Li Jinglong finished listening, he suddenly realized: "It turns out that this is the person Yun Wen was talking about."
Seeing that Zhu Di was a little confused, Li Jinglong explained to Zhu Di that he had just come out of the Palace of Spring Harmony.
Then he said: "Yun Wen is trying to win over the officials and try to stabilize the grandson's position."
Zhu Di sneered and said, "Emperor Yunwen's nephew is really ridiculous. With the emperor around, what's the point in attracting more officials. Could it be that those officials dared to oppose the emperor's decree?"
"Furthermore, the identity of the eldest nephew is the orthodox one. Maybe once the emperor announces the identity of the eldest nephew, those Confucian civil servants will support him faster than anyone else."
Hearing what Zhu Di said, Li Jinglong couldn't help asking: "Cousin, is it possible that Zhu Ying is really His Royal Highness King Yu? This, why does it feel so unlikely, is there someone behind the scenes?"
Zhu Di glanced at Li Jinglong, hesitated for a moment, and said: "Although it's a bit unbelievable, but from the current point of view, Zhu Ying is indeed the king's eldest nephew."
"The possibility of being manipulated is unlikely. Zhu Ying is not a simple person, so don't underestimate him. You were in charge of the tea and horse trade in Xifan before, and you must have heard of the Qunying Chamber of Commerce."
Li Jinglong heard the words and said: "Of course I know, the name of the Qunying Chamber of Commerce is very famous in Xifan, and I have dealt with a lot of their people."
"To put it bluntly, after crossing the border of the Ming Dynasty, the tea-horse exchange market was basically controlled by the Qunying Chamber of Commerce. Among many Fan clans, this Chamber of Commerce has a very high reputation, and many native fans are extremely supportive of it."
"Especially the Snowflake Salt from the Qunying Chamber of Commerce, which is a best-seller in Xifan. Almost no one dares to offend them by controlling the quota."
Speaking of this, Li Jinglong couldn't help asking: "Biao Shu means that Zhu Ying is related to the Qunying Chamber of Commerce?"
Zhu Di snorted coldly, and said, "What does it mean to be related to the Qunying Chamber of Commerce? The behind-the-scenes owner of this chamber of commerce is Zhu Ying himself."
"This, how is this possible. I have also inquired about the owner behind the Qunying Chamber of Commerce. It is said that this person has no head but no tail. He appears and disappears in the Western Regions, deserts, and grasslands. It is difficult to find traces."
"If Zhu Ying were His Royal Highness King Yu, he would only be eighteen this year. The Qunying Chamber of Commerce was established five years ago. How old was he at that time, 13 years old? How is this possible."
Li Jinglong exclaimed.
The Qunying Chamber of Commerce is not well-known in Daming, but in the frontiers of Ming Dynasty, it is especially trading in snowflake salt, tea, horses, silk, etc.
You can't get around the Qunying Chamber of Commerce.
Not only because the Qunying Chamber of Commerce has a large amount of precious goods in its hands, but the main reason is that the Qunying Chamber of Commerce also has a very strong cavalry team on the border of Daming.
If some black merchants play the idea of the Qunying Chamber of Commerce, they will definitely not see the sun the next day.
Qunying Chamber of Commerce itself, there are many large tribes joining.
The Mongolian Khanates, the leaders of the larger forces on the grassland, and even the generals, nobles, and even kings of some small countries all have a lot of profit and dividends in the Qunying Chamber of Commerce.
Such a huge complex of interests, without participating in the struggle, or impacting Ming Dynasty.
It is hard to shake at all, and the impact is widespread.
"There's nothing impossible about this. You know the foundation of the Qunying Chamber of Commerce. His boss can still be manipulated." Zhu Di said.
Zhu Di said it lightly, but Li Jinglong was always in shock.
In fact, in terms of the degree of understanding, Zhu Di really does not have a deeper understanding than Li Jinglong.
After all, the status is different. For Zhu Di, although he knew that the Qunying Chamber of Commerce was very big, he felt that it was just a chamber of commerce in his heart, and he had a lot of money, that's all.
Li Jinglong is different. He is in charge of the tea-horse market in Xifan, and he has to deal with it in person. Naturally, he can understand the terrifying influence of the Qunying Chamber of Commerce in this process.
To what extent did it affect it?
In other words, even if the tea-horse trade in Daming Xifan is closed, the Qunying Chamber of Commerce can provide a large amount of tea to the nomads.
The situation of bad tea being exchanged for good horses is being leveled out by the Qunying Chamber of Commerce.
Not only has the transaction volume of the tea-horse market been reduced, but even more nobles have stopped buying tea from Daming.
This is also the reason why Li Jinglong was transferred to Xifan to be in charge of the tea and horse trade.
The main purpose is to investigate the specific situation of the tea-horse market.
"No wonder, I presented the situation of the tea-horse trade market to His Majesty, and until today, His Majesty has not come down with any order."
Li Jinglong said suddenly.
Presumably, His Majesty already knew that the Qunying Chamber of Commerce was controlled by Zhu Ying, and it was entirely his own property, even the eldest grandson's.
Naturally no action is taken.
Zhu Di said again: "Father now attaches great importance to his eldest nephew, especially after the Xiaoling Mausoleum, he has completely believed in Zhu Ying's life experience, and even sent many memorials to his eldest nephew for review."
Hearing this, Li Jinglong said with some doubts: "Then why didn't His Majesty call His Highness the eldest grandson directly into the palace?"
Hearing the title of His Highness Changsun, Zhu Di took a deep look at Li Jinglong, and then said: "You work in the Zuojun Governor's Mansion, so you probably know about the recent transfer."
"Liang Guogong, Song Guogong, Ying Guogong and others have been summoned back to the capital. This is the intention of the father to let the elder nephew fully control the military power, and then enter the palace to reveal his identity."
"At that time, who can shake the position of the eldest nephew. As for Yun Yun, heh, thinking about the position of the grandson is really a dream."
Li Jinglong quickly understood what Zhu Di meant.
Silent for a while.
The current situation can be said to be quite clear, with His Majesty guarding it, no one in Ming Dynasty can stir up any troubles.
Then the position of Grandson Zhu Ying is unstoppable.
The most critical reason is that Zhu Ying is still the owner of Qunying Chamber of Commerce.
A ruthless person who founded a huge chamber of commerce at the age of 13, and he is also the eldest grandson of Ming Dynasty.
Adding two and two together, Li Jinglong suddenly shuddered.
(End of this chapter)
